Time and Cost Estimates

  • Mostar Bridge & Old Town: 3 hours, free entry
  • Durmitor National Park: 4 hours, approx. €5 entry
  • Kotor Bay Old Town: 3 hours, free
  • Butrint National Park: 3 hours, approx. €7 entry
  • Rozafa Castle, Shkodra: 2 hours, approx. €2 entry
  • Gjirokastër Castle and Museum: 2.5 hours, approx. €5 entry
  • Lake Skadar Boat Ride: 2 hours, approx. €10
  • Fuel for entire trip (~6000 km): approx. €400-€500 (depending on vehicle efficiency)
  • Accommodation: Budget guesthouses and hostels, approx. €20-40 per night for 14 nights (~€280-560)

Total Estimated Cost: €710 - €1090 (excluding food and personal expenses)

Tips

  • To extend the trip: Consider adding a few days in Montenegro’s national parks or the Albanian Riviera to enjoy more beach time and nature hikes.
  • To reduce the trip duration: Skip some longer inland detours, such as reducing stops in southern Albania or shortening your stay in Bosnia, focusing mainly on coastal highlights and quicker routes back.
  • Plan accommodations ahead, especially during peak tourist seasons, to avoid last-minute stress.
  • Carry local currencies for small purchases in rural areas where card payments may not be available.
